Position Type: Substitute Coverage - Grade 11We are currently hiring Substitute Food Service Aides to provide flexible, as-needed coverage within our central kitchen and food service operations. This is a great opportunity for someone seeking a meaningful role with schedule flexibility.What You'll Do:As a Food Service Assistant, you'll support the day-to-day operations of OCO's central kitchen and meal programs. Your responsibilities will include:Assisting with the daily needs of the kitchenWorking as an integral part of a team and stepping in wherever neededProperly storing, caring for, and inventorying food and suppliesFollowing all dress codes, safety rules, and sanitation requirementsPreparing, cooking, collating, and packing components of daily mealsAssisting with hot, cold, and frozen food preparationCleaning your workspace, equipment, and tools throughout the dayHelping with full end-of-day clean-up, including pots, pans, utensils, and equipmentWorking additional hours as needed to meet program demand Attending monthly food service safety & sanitation trainings Learning additional roles within Nutrition Services to provide backup coverage when needed Using a computer for basic tasks such as email, required trainings, and inventory documentation Performing other related tasks as assignedJob Requirements:We're seeking someone dependable, flexible, and committed to safety and teamwork. Applicants must:Follow all NYS Department of Health Safety & Sanitation CodesWork independently and follow daily checklists Maintain program and client confidentialityRead and accurately follow lists, recipes, and instructionsHave or be willing to learn basic computer skillsCommunicate effectively and model teamwork and cooperationUse sound judgment and stay organized in a fast-paced environmentLift 35 lbs or more regularlyBe flexible with duties and hours as neededPerform physical tasks such as standing, bending, kneeling, and liftingHold a valid NYS Driver's License and have access to a reliable, insured vehicleMinimum Qualifications:High School Diploma or GED andAt least three months of related experienceEquivalent combinations of education and experience will also be considered Why Join OCO?By supporting our Nutrition Services program, you'll play an essential role in delivering healthy meals and supporting the well-being of our community.
